Medical Billing Services for Scaling Practice 

Medical billing services have become an important part of modern healthcare operations because they handle the financial and administrative side of healthcare claims processing. Their role includes submitting claims, verifying insurance eligibility, posting payments, managing denials, following up on unpaid claims, and supporting end-to-end revenue cycle management. Today, 9 out of 10 medical practices reported higher operating costs in both 2024 and 2025, and with U.S. physicians losing an estimated $125 billion annually to billing errors and claim denials, the financial headroom to grow simply isn’t there. For most independent practices today, scaling isn’t a strategy problem. It’s a money problem. That’s why an outsourced medical billing services company comes to help. 

Are Medical Practices Struggling to Grow?

Yes, many medical practices are struggling to grow due to rising administrative and operational pressures. Independent practices often manage a heavy workload related to insurance verification, claim management, compliance, scheduling, and other non-clinical responsibilities. According to MGMA, physicians spend nearly 24% of their working hours on administrative tasks, and almost two-thirds believe this burden negatively impacts patient care.

As patient expectations continue to rise, practices that fail to adopt modern systems such as online appointment booking, digital patient intake, and automated workflows often struggle to manage increasing patient volumes efficiently, which can be easily done by the best medical billing service company.

At the same time, practices looking to expand by hiring new providers, upgrading facilities, or investing in advanced technologies also face significant financial risks. Smaller clinics especially struggle to balance operational costs, revenue cycle inefficiencies, delayed reimbursements, and staff burnout. According to Medscape’s 2024 Physician Burnout Report, 63% of physicians identified excessive bureaucratic tasks as a major cause of burnout. Without streamlined operations and efficient practice management systems, sustainable growth becomes difficult for many healthcare providers.

Is Outsource Medical Billing Services the Key to Scaling Your Practice?

Practices that outsource billing see a 15–25% improvement in overall revenue collection. So, as per the data, yes, outsourcing medical billing services can be a key to scaling your practice. Because scaling your practice does not only mean getting more patients. It also means your revenue is stable, your denials are low, and your team is free to focus on care, and not billing. There is also the question of capacity. In-house billing teams cost between 8–12% of collections when you factor in salaries, training, and software. Outsourced billing runs at 5–8%, and unlike a fixed internal team, an outsourced partner scales with your patient volume automatically, without the overhead of hiring every time you grow.

Outsourcing medical billing is the process of hiring a specialized third-party company to manage a healthcare provider’s medical billing and revenue cycle management (RCM), including claim submission, payment processing, denial management, and insurance follow-ups.
